In 1833, Joshua Harrison Bruce entered the world in Ladoga, Montgomery, Indiana, United States, born to Charles Polk Bruce Of Nelson Eldest Son Of Maj William Bruce Widower Of Angelina Wright Husband Of Nancy Paris Harrison Norsctam And Nancy Paris Harrison. Joshua Harrison Bruce married Sarah E Lafollette, and had children including Angeline Bruce, Charles Robert Bruce, Eliza Ellen Bruce, James Milton Bruce, Joshua Harrison Bruce, Mabel Orinda Bruce, Mary Paris Bruce, Sarah M Bruce, William Wallace Bruce. Joshua Harrison Bruce passed away in 1891 in Getty Grove, Stearns, Minnesota, United States.
